How they compare
Morocco currently reports 182,838 1000 USD against 63,666 1000 USD in Spain, a difference of 119,172 1000 USD.
That makes Morocco's figure about 2.9 times Spain's.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 34 shared years of data; in 1991 it was Spain ahead.
Morocco ranks 2nd and Spain ranks 4th of 44 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Morocco averaged higher in 2 and Spain in 2.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Morocco | Spain |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 31,743 1000 USD | 78,380 1000 USD | 46,637 1000 USD | Spain |
| 2000s | 48,565 1000 USD | 51,984 1000 USD | 3,419 1000 USD | Spain |
| 2010s | 92,719 1000 USD | 48,680 1000 USD | 44,039 1000 USD | Morocco |
| 2020s | 107,237 1000 USD | 49,537 1000 USD | 57,700 1000 USD | Morocco |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
The domain provides detailed data on the value of agricultural production that is calculated by the agricultural production data and the price data at farm gate. Thus, the value of production measures the agricultural production in monetary terms at the farm gate level.
